Do make an effort to find a distinguished contractor. Picking up the phone and calling the first garden paving, patio laying, groundworks or driveway company you see that covers the Hove area can be unwise. In fact, there are an array of questions you should be looking to ask a contractor before they take on important home improvement projects – and it’s even more essential when you’re investing in something that can prove a fair bit of an investment, like property extensions.

So what should you be asking? How many years of experience they have. Whether they’re insured and offer guarantees. What materials they work with. If their team is qualified and accredited. And, whether you can see some past examples of projects.

Don’t neglect to consider different materials. We work with a real range of materials, for example with block paving to handle garden paving and patio laying. If you’re bringing us in as your chosen driveway company to restore the approach to your property, you can choose from a resin bound driveway, tarmac driveway, or something more on the utilitarian side like concrete.

By weighing up these different materials, specifically how they’ll look and suit your property’s existing architectural features, the amount of maintenance involved in keeping them ship shape, their durability and lifespan, and other factors such as permeability, you’ll ensure you make the right choice and are pleased for many, many years to come.
